Complete genome sequence of Lactobacillus rhamnosus strain LRB.

Authors: Biswas, Saswati and Biswas, Indranil

Lactobacillus rhamnosus is a Gram-positive facultative heterofermentative lactic acid bacterium. It is often isolated from the gastrointestinal tract, mouth, vagina, and fermented dairy products. We have isolated the L. rhamnosus strain LRB from a healthy baby tooth that had naturally fallen out. Here, we report the annotated whole-genome sequence of LRB. Copyright © 2016 Biswas and Biswas.
